I use Emby (jellyfin is a fork of Emby right) and I think it's just a limitation of how it's written where you can't customize the regex that it uses to identify the show. I had this happen for Naruto Shippuden where it thinks they are the movies rather than the show, because anime has problems with how it defines seasons , I don't think there is a way to fix it other than a code change at the source , and manually changing the metadata yourself in the meantime
